What Determines the Price of a Toyota Fortuner in Hong Kong?
Okay, so you're probably wondering, "How much does a Toyota Fortuner actually cost in Hong Kong?" Well, it's not as straightforward as just looking up a number. Several factors influence the final price tag, so let's dive into those:
- Model Year: Just like with any car, the model year plays a huge role. Newer models with the latest features and tech will naturally command higher prices. Older models might be more budget-friendly, but keep in mind that they might lack some of the newer advancements and could have higher mileage. When looking at different model years, consider what features are must-haves for you versus what you can live without. For example, the difference between a 2018 and a 2023 model might include upgraded safety features, a more modern infotainment system, or even engine improvements. Doing your homework on the specific differences can help you make a smart choice that fits your needs and your wallet. Also, remember that older models might have higher maintenance costs down the line, so factor that into your long-term budget.
- Trim Level: The trim level is another big one. Toyota usually offers the Fortuner in different trims, like a base model, a mid-range version, and a top-of-the-line option. Each trim comes with different features, such as leather seats, advanced safety systems, upgraded sound systems, and cosmetic enhancements. Naturally, the higher the trim level, the more you'll pay. Think about what features are essential for you. Do you really need that premium sound system, or would you be happy with the standard one? Are leather seats a must-have, or is cloth upholstery perfectly fine? Prioritizing your needs will help you narrow down the trim levels and find one that balances features and price.
- Condition: This is a no-brainer. A brand-new Fortuner will cost significantly more than a used one. However, even within the used market, the condition can vary greatly. Factors like mileage, accident history, and overall maintenance all affect the price. A well-maintained Fortuner with low mileage will fetch a higher price than one with a lot of wear and tear. Always get a thorough inspection before buying a used car, and don't be afraid to ask for a vehicle history report. This can reveal any potential red flags, such as past accidents or major repairs. Remember, a lower price might seem tempting, but it could end up costing you more in the long run if the car requires extensive repairs.
- Dealer vs. Private Seller: Where you buy the Fortuner also matters. Dealerships typically offer warranties and certified pre-owned options, which can provide peace of mind but usually come at a premium. Private sellers might offer lower prices, but you'll need to do your due diligence to ensure the car is in good condition. Weigh the pros and cons of each option. A dealership might offer financing options and a more streamlined buying process, while a private seller might be more willing to negotiate on price. Consider your comfort level with each option and choose the one that best suits your needs.
- Market Demand: Supply and demand always play a role. If the Fortuner is a hot commodity in Hong Kong, prices might be higher due to increased demand. Limited availability can also drive up prices. Keep an eye on market trends and be patient. If you're not in a rush, you might be able to find a better deal if you wait for the market to cool down a bit. Also, consider buying during off-peak seasons, such as the end of the year, when dealerships are trying to clear out their inventory.
Finding Toyota Fortuner for Sale in Hong Kong
Alright, so you know what affects the price. Now, where can you actually find a Toyota Fortuner for sale in Hong Kong?
- Official Toyota Dealerships: This is the most obvious place to start. Official dealerships offer brand-new Fortuners and often have certified pre-owned options as well. You can be confident in the quality and reliability of the vehicles, and you'll also get a warranty. However, prices at dealerships tend to be higher than from private sellers. Dealerships also offer financing options and after-sales service, which can be convenient. Check out the Toyota Hong Kong website to find a list of authorized dealers.
- Used Car Platforms: Online platforms like Carousell, Asia Motors, and 28car.com are popular places to find used cars in Hong Kong. You'll find a wide variety of Fortuners listed at different price points. However, it's crucial to do your research and inspect the car thoroughly before making a purchase. These platforms connect you with private sellers and smaller dealerships, so the level of service and warranty options can vary greatly. Be sure to read reviews and check the seller's reputation before contacting them. Always arrange a test drive and get the car inspected by a trusted mechanic before finalizing the deal.
- Used Car Dealerships: Hong Kong has many independent used car dealerships. These dealerships can offer a good middle ground between official dealerships and private sellers. They often have a selection of well-maintained Fortuners at competitive prices. However, it's still important to do your research and choose a reputable dealership. Ask about warranties and service records, and don't be afraid to negotiate the price. Check online reviews and ask for recommendations from friends or family. A good used car dealership will be transparent about the car's history and condition, and they'll be willing to answer all your questions.
- Auctions: Keep an eye out for car auctions in Hong Kong. Auctions can be a great place to find deals on used cars, but they also come with risks. You'll need to do your research and inspect the car carefully before bidding, as you usually can't return it if you find problems later. Auctions can be fast-paced and competitive, so it's important to set a budget and stick to it. Attend a few auctions beforehand to get a feel for the process and learn how to bid effectively. Be aware that you might need to pay additional fees, such as auction fees and registration fees.
Tips for Getting the Best Deal on a Toyota Fortuner
Okay, you're on the hunt. Here are some tips to help you score the best deal:
- Do Your Research: Knowledge is power. Before you start shopping, research the different Fortuner models, trim levels, and their typical prices in Hong Kong. This will give you a baseline to work with and help you identify good deals. Use online resources, car reviews, and price guides to get a sense of the market value. Also, check for any recalls or common problems associated with the Fortuner model you're interested in. The more information you have, the better equipped you'll be to negotiate a fair price.
- Negotiate: Don't be afraid to haggle, especially when buying from a private seller or a used car dealership. Start by offering a lower price than what they're asking, and be prepared to walk away if they don't budge. Do your research and know the market value of the car. Point out any flaws or issues you find during the inspection to justify your offer. Be polite but firm, and don't be afraid to counteroffer. Remember, the worst they can say is no, and you might be surprised at how much you can save with a little negotiation.
- Get a Pre-Purchase Inspection: Always, always, always get a pre-purchase inspection from a trusted mechanic before buying a used car. This can reveal hidden problems that you might not notice yourself. A mechanic can check the engine, transmission, brakes, and other critical components to ensure they're in good working order. The cost of an inspection is well worth it, as it can save you from costly repairs down the road. If the seller refuses to allow an inspection, that's a red flag, and you should probably walk away.
- Consider Financing Options: Explore different financing options to find the best interest rate and terms. Compare offers from different banks and credit unions. A lower interest rate can save you a significant amount of money over the life of the loan. Also, consider the length of the loan. A shorter loan term will result in higher monthly payments but lower overall interest paid. A longer loan term will result in lower monthly payments but higher overall interest paid. Choose the loan term that best fits your budget and financial goals.
- Be Patient: Don't rush into a purchase. Take your time to find the right Fortuner at the right price. The more patient you are, the more likely you are to find a good deal. Check multiple sources, compare prices, and don't be afraid to walk away if you're not comfortable with the deal. Sometimes, the best deals come when you're least expecting them.
